Carolyn Gombell Is Not a Real Person: #JusticeforCarolyn Is a Campaign Against Twitter Refusing to Delete Trump’s Tweets Accusing Joe Scarborough of Murdering Lori Klausutis

Fascinating use of social media. To be clear, this story about “Carolyn Gombell” is a fabrication, intended to spark Twitter to take action against people (such as Donald Trump) who use Twitter to publicize unfounded accusations.

Will that matter to people who share it? It’s parody accounts, not journalists, who are retweeting this story as if it’s true. Will that matter to people who already think “the media” are unified behind a single America-hating agenda?
